A computer-based headset is wearable hardware which the user puts over the head, connected to a computer that runs the VR software and sends the audio/visual information to the headset. Latency represents the time delay between the input of the user and the realization of the action in the virtual world. Computer-Based Headset.

Latency How soon after you move your hand do you see movement represented on your virtual hand? That's latency - the delay between real and virtual movement.

He adds that one of the main causes of motion sickness in VR experiences is poor latency. When a delay in latency occurs, your real and virtual movements no longer match, knocking the equilibrium out of balance and causing ‘cybersickness.’
